Adam James and Jane Smith are partners. The entry to distribute a net loss to both partners is

A. debit, Adam James, Drawing; debit, Jane Smith, Drawing; credit, Income Summary.

B. debit, Income Summary; credit, Adam James, Capital; credit, Jane Smith, Capital.

C. debit, Adam James, Capital; debit, Jane Smith, Capital; credit, Income Summary.

D. debit, Income Summary; credit, Adam James, Drawing; credit, Jane Smith, Drawing.

0 0
Add a comment Improve this question Transcribed image text
Answer #1

Loss should be transferred to capital account of the partners.

Debit Adam James Capital

Debit Jane Smith Capital

Credit income summary

Option. C
